Role Summary

PLOS is seeking to enhance its change management capacity and expertise through the addition of a Senior Change Manager. The Senior Change Manager will drive change initiatives across the organization, ensuring these are well-contextualized, effectively communicated, and sustainably embedded. Reporting to the Chief of Staff, this role will shape and refine PLOS’ approach to change, providing both strategic guidance and hands-on execution. As a partner to senior leadership, managers, and stakeholders across the organization, this individual will play a critical role in ensuring alignment across initiatives and developing frameworks that enable agility and adaptability as PLOS enters a new era of strategy and operations.

Responsibilities
Establish and Evolve Change Management Practices
  • Establish, refine, and evolve PLOS’ approach to change management, ensuring it aligns with our strategy, culture, and best practice.
  • Act as a trusted advisor to leadership and management, providing expert guidance on driving and sustaining change initiatives.
  • Proactively identify and address barriers to successful change, ensuring a people-centered approach.
  • Partner with Internal Communications to develop clear, consistent and engaging messaging around change efforts.
Lead and Embed Change Initiatives
  • Assess organizational readiness and capacity to absorb change; develop tailored strategies to manage and sustain major initiatives.
  • Ensure alignment between change initiatives and broader strategic goals, proactively identifying dependencies and risks and setting an appropriate cadence of major change for the organization.
  • Lead stakeholder engagement and impact assessment, developing tailored approaches to specific groups and individuals to minimize resistance and maximize adoption.
  • Own the planning, execution, and review of change initiatives to ensure cohesive, timely delivery, measurable impact, and long-term sustainability.
Measure Impact and Drive Continuous Improvement
  • Develop and implement metrics to track adoption, effectiveness, and sustainability of change initiatives.
  • Continuously refine change approaches and drive improvement based on data, stakeholder feedback, and lessons learned.
  • Build robust reporting mechanisms to ensure transparency and communicate progress to business leadership and key stakeholders.
Evolve Leadership Capability in Change Management
  • Develop trusted relationships with senior leadership and key stakeholders across the business, providing coaching and support to help drive and support change within teams and across the organization.
  • Model and reinforce leadership behaviors that reinforce agility, adaptability, and proactive engagement with change.
  • Develop toolkits, frameworks, and training programs that equip managers and leaders with the skills to lead through change.
Knowledge and Skills
  • Proven ability to drive large scale transformational change, balancing strategic oversight with hands-on execution.
  • Strong influencing and relationship-building skills, particularly at the executive level.
  • Deep expertise in utilizing different approaches and frameworks for change management, including agile and iterative approaches.
  • Experience navigating complex organizational dynamics, identifying resistance points, and developing targeted interventions.
  • Ability to embed change within business processes, ensuring long-term sustainability and operational alignment.
  • Experience with Product Operating Models and cross-functional ways of working (preferred but not required).
Qualifications
  • Adkar certification or equivalent change management qualification preferred.
  • Prior knowledge of scholarly publishing and/or the Open Science movement preferred.

About PLOS

Building on a strong legacy of pioneering innovation, PLOS continues to be a catalyst in open science, reimagining models to meet open science principles, removing barriers and promoting inclusion in knowledge creation and sharing, and publishing research outputs that enable everyone to learn from, reuse and build upon scientific knowledge.

Our work is supported by a highly skilled global in-house team, partnerships with local scholarly organizations, and the valued contributions of a diverse, international community of scientific researchers.
